Identify the product formed in the following reaction. CH ₃ CH ₂ Mg Br [ ii) dil. HCl ] i) Dry ice/ dry ether Product

Options

  1. AEthanoic acid
  2. BPropanoic acid
  3. C2-Methylpropanoic acid
  4. DButanoic acid

Correct answer

B. Propanoic acid

Step-by-step solution

Grignard Reaction with Carbon Dioxide Ethylmagnesium bromide ( CH ₃ CH ₂ MgBr ) reacts as a nucleophile with carbon dioxide ( CO ₂ ) in dry ether, attacking the electrophilic carbon to form a magnesium carboxylate salt. CH ₃ CH ₂ MgBr + CO ₂ CH ₃ CH ₂ COO ⁻ Mg ⁺ Br Hydrolysis with dilute hydrochloric acid liberates the carboxylic acid. CH ₃ CH ₂ COO ⁻ Mg ⁺ Br + HCl CH ₃ CH ₂ COOH + MgBrCl The product is propanoic acid ( CH ₃ CH ₂ COOH ), corresponding to option B.
